  • Purpose: The epidermal growth factor receptor (EGFR) family plays a crucial role in the growth of malignant tumors. EGFR and human EGFR 2 (HER2) protein overexpression are associated with an unfavorable prognosis and are important therapeutic targets in breast cancer. The aim of this study was to evaluate the relationship between EGFR and HER2 expression and clinicopathological factors in papillary thyroid carcinoma (PTC) at a single institution. Methods: A total of 129 consecutive patients with PTC were enrolled in this study and underwent thyroid surgery between October 2013 and February 2015. EGFR and HER2 protein expression was evaluated in the 129 primary tumors by immunohistochemistry, and the results were compared with the clinicopathological features. Results: Of the 129 PTC tumors, 20 (15.5%) were HER2 positive, and 109 (84.5%) were HER2 negative. Moreover, EGFR positivity were observed in 111 (86%) tumors. The mean age of the patients was $46.3{\pm}11.9years$ (range, 20-74 years), and the mean tumor size was $1.08{\pm}0.75cm$ (range, 0.2-3.5 cm). Tumor size, extrathyroidal extension, histological subtype, and TNM stage were not significantly associated with EGFR or HER2 expression. Meanwhile, high Ki-67 labeling index was significantly associated with EGFR expression (P=0.002), HER2 expression was significantly associated with younger age (${\leq}45years$) and cervical lymph node metastasis. Conclusion: Based on our data, it is not clear whether EGFR and HER2 expression is associated with tumor aggressiveness in PTC.

  • Objective : Silent corticotroph adenomas (SCA) are endocrine-inactive pituitary adenomas with positive immunohistochemistry staining for adrenocorticotropic hormone (ACTH). We investigated whether SCA-associated clinical profiles were more aggressive than hormonally negative adenomas (HNA). Methods : Among 627 patients with pathologically proven endocrine-inactive pituitary adenomas between 2004 and 2013, positive immunohistochemistry revealed 55 SCAs and 411 HNAs. Surgical outcomes and radiological and endocrinological characteristics were compared. Results : Strong female predominance was observed in the SCA group (p<0.001). Cavernous sinus invasion was identified in 22 (40%) SCA patients and 72 (17.6%) HNA patients (p<0.001). There were no differences in ACTH or cortisol levels between the two groups. The incidence of preoperative hypopituitarism and postoperative hormonal outcome did not differ between two groups. Total resection was achieved in 35 patients (63.7%) with SCA and 332 patients (80.8%) with HNA (p=0.007). When tumors were completely removed, recurrence rates were not statistically different between two groups (p=0.60). When complete resection was not achieved, tumors regrew from these remnants in seven patients (35.0%) with SCA and 12 patients (15.2%) with HNA (p=0.05). Conclusion : Total surgical resection for SCA is often challenging as these tumors frequently invade a cavernous sinus. Early remnant tumor intervention is justified, because untreated residual pituitary tumors regrow when patients were followed up for a long time. Prophylactic radiotherapy is not warranted for completely resected SCAs as tumor recurrence is uncommon.

  • Squamous cell/adenosquamous carcinoma (SC/ASC) of the gallbladder are rare tumors and there are few clinical reports in the literature. Herein we report our clinical experience with 46 patients with SC/ASC and 80 with adenocarcinoma (AC). Expression of EphB1 and Ephrin-B in each tumor was determined using immunohistochemical methods for determination of correlations with prognosis. There was no difference in EphB1 and Ephrin-B expression between SC/ASC and AC tumors (P>0.05), but greater expression in those less than 3 cm in diameter, stage I or II (TNM stage), with no lymph node metastases, with no local invasion and treated with radical resection was apparent. Expression of EphB1 (P<0.05) and Ephrin-B (P<0.01) was higher in well differentiated than in poorly differentiated AC tumors. Kaplan-Meier survival analysis indicated that degree of differentiation, tumor diameter, lymph node metastases, local invasion, surgical approach and expression rate of EphB1 and Ephrin-B were closely related to the survival of SC/ASC (P<0.05) and AC patients (P<0.01). Patients with tumors that positive expressed EphB1 and Ephrin-B, whether it is SC/ASC ($P_{SC/ASC}$ =0.000) or AC ($P_{AC}$ =0.000 or $P_{AC}$ =0.002) had longer survival than those negative expression. Cox multivariate analysis indicated a negative correlation between expression of EphB1 or Ephrin-B and overall survival. Hence, EphB1 and Ephrin-B could be regarded as independent good prognostic factorsand important biological markers for SC/ASC and AC of gallbladder.

  • Purpose : The present study was carried out to determine the diagnostic usefulness of bone scan for evaluating jaw bone extension of oral cancer. Materials and Methods : Medical records, preoperative bone scans, computerized tomographic (CT) scans, conventional radiographs, and findings of histopathologic sections of twenty patients who had been treated for oral malignant tumors by a resection of mandible and soft tissue at Chonnam University Hospital from January, 1994 to September, 1999 were analyzed. Results : In 13 cases which showed histopathologically positive, preoperative bone scans were positive in 12 (92.3%) and false negative in 1 (7.7%). Preoperative CT scans were positive in 9 (69.2%) and false negative in 4 (30.8%) of the 13 cases. Preoperative conventional radiographs were positive in 8 (61.5%) and false negative in 5 (38.5%) of the 13 cases. In 7 cases showing negative histopathologic findings, 1 (14.3%) was in CT scans and 2 (28.6%) were false positive in preoperative conventional radiographs. Conclusion : These results suggest that bone scan is more sensitive and reliable method for evaluating jaw bone extension of oral cancer than conventional radiographs or CT scans.

  • 목적: STAT3는 주요 세포 진행과정을 조절하는 암유전자로, 활성화되면 여러 악성종양의 생물학적, 임상적 특징과 연관된다고 알려져 있고, 한편 배아줄기세포와 연관된 유전자이기도 하다. 본 연구에서는 연골종양의 발생에 STAT3 활성화가 관여하는지 살펴보았다. 대상 및 방법: 총 33예의 각종 양성 및 악성 연골종양에서 STAT3 활성화를 살펴보기 위해 활성화된 $pSTAT3^{tyr705}$에 특이한 단클론성 항체를 이용한 면역조직화학법을 시행하였다. 결과: 통상적인 연골육종 17예 중, 조직학적 등급 3의 연골육종은 3예(50%)에서 pSTAT3에 양성이었고, 등급 1 및 2 연골육종은 모두 음성이었다. 즉 pSTAT3 양성도는 조직학적 등급과 통계학적으로 유의한 상관관계(p=0.0432)를 나타내었다. 또한 투명세포 연골육종 2예(50%)도 pSTAT3에 양성이었다. 내연골종, 연골모세포종, 연골점액양섬유종 등 12예의 양성 연골종양 중 6예(50%)에서 pSTAT3가 관찰되었다. 결론: STAT3 활성화는 통상적인 연골육종 중 고도의 조직학적 분화도가 나쁜 등급에서 주로 발견된다. 배아줄기세포 표지자인 STAT3가 양성 및 악성 연골종양 일부에서 활성화되는 것으로 미루어보아 연골 기원 종양에서도 악성종양의 줄기세포 가설을 제안할 수 있다.

  • Objective: To evaluate 99mtechnetium-three polyethylene glycol spacers-arginine-glycine-aspartic acid (99mTc-3PRGD2) single-photon emission computed tomography (SPECT)/computed tomography (CT) imaging for diagnosing lymph node metastasis of primary malignant lung neoplasms. Materials and Methods: We prospectively enrolled 26 patients with primary malignant lung tumors who underwent 99mTc-3PRGD2 SPECT/CT and 18F-fluorodeoxyglucose (18F-FDG) positron emission tomography (PET)/CT imaging. Both imaging methods were analyzed in qualitative (visual dichotomous and 5-point grades for lymph nodes and lung tumors, respectively) and semiquantitative (maximum tissue-to-background radioactive count) manners for the lymph nodes and lung tumors. The performance of the differentiation of lymph nodes with and without metastasis was determined at the per-lymph node station and per-patient levels using histopathological results as the reference standard. Results: Total 42 stations had metastatic lymph nodes and 136 stations had benign lymph nodes. The differences between metastatic and benign lymph nodes in the visual qualitative and semiquantitative analyses of 99mTc-3PRGD2 SPECT/CT and 18F-FDG PET/CT were statistically significant (all P < 0.001). The area under the receiver operating characteristic curve (AUC) in the semi-quantitative analysis of 99mTc-3PRGD2 SPECT/CT was 0.908 (95% confidence interval [CI], 0.851-0.966), and the sensitivity, specificity, positive predictive value, and negative predictive value were 0.86 (36/42), 0.88 (120/136), 0.69 (36/52), and 0.95 (120/126), respectively. Among the 26 patients (including two patients each with two lung tumors), 15 had pathologically confirmed lymph node metastasis. The difference between primary lung lesions in patients with and without lymph node metastasis was statistically significant only in the semi-quantitative analysis of 99mTc-3PRGD2 SPECT/CT (P = 0.007), with an AUC of 0.807 (95% CI, 0.641-0.974). Conclusion: 99mTc-3PRGD2 SPECT/CT imaging may notably perform in the direct diagnosis of lymph node metastasis of primary malignant lung tumors and indirectly predict the presence of lymph node metastasis through uptake in the primary lesions.

  • Immunohistochemical studies on S-100 protein and lactoferrin were carried out to evaluate the existence and distribution pattern of S-100 protein and lactoferrin positive cells in salivary gland tumors. The specimens used were 25 cases of pleomorphic adenoma, 2 cases of monomorphic adenoma, 2 cases of mucoepidermoid tumor, 2 cases of acinic cell tumor, 3 cases of adenoid cystic carcinoma and 2 cases of adenocarcinoma occured in parotid and submandibular salivary gland. ABC kits(Dako corp. Copenhagen. Denmark) for S-100 protein and lactoferrin were used. The results obtained were summarized as follows: In the normal salivary gland. positive immunoreaction for S-100 protein was observed in myoepithelial cells of acini and intercalated ducts. Positive immunoreaction for lactoferrin was observed in serous acinic cells, epithelial cells of intercalated ducts, and excretory material in the ductal lumina. In the pleomorphic and monomorphic adenomas. most of tumor cells were positive for S-100 protein, while luminal tumor cells in gland-like or duct-like structures were rarely positive for lactoferrin. In mucoepidermoid tumor, most of squamous cells and a few of intermediate cells were positive for S-100 protein, but all of tumor cells were negative for lactoferrin. In acinic cell tumor, most of tumor cells were positive for lactoferrin, but all of tumor cells were negative for S-100 protein. In adenoid cystic carcinoma, basaloid tumor cells in trabecular structure were focally positive for S-100 protein. and in adenocarcinoma, many of tumor cells were posivive for both S-100 protein and lactoferrin. Thus, according to the embryonic stage of the development of the tumor cell origin, it was possible to classify the salivary gland tumor as followings: mucoepidermoid carcinoma which originated from the earliest stage, acinic cell tumor which originated from the end stage. Between these two extremes, there were pleomorphic adenoma, adenoid cystic carcinoma and adenocarcinoma which originated in the middle stage of the development of .the salivary glands. Based on the above results, it can be stated that S-100 protein is demonstrated in tumor cells orginated from myoepithelial cells and lactoferrin in glandular differentiated tumor cells.

  • Background: Human leukocyte antigen (HLA)-G-positive gastric cancers are associated with poor survival, but links with tumor escape mechanisms remain to be determined. Materials and Methods: We used immunohistochemistry to investigate HLA-G expression, tumor infiltrating CD8+ T lymphocytes, and Treg cells in 52 gastric cancer patients. Results: There were 29 cancer-related deaths during the follow-up period. Kaplan-Meier analysis indicated that patients with HLA-G-positive (n=16) primary tumors had a significantly poorer prognosis than patients with HLA-G-negative tumors (n=36, p=0.008). The median survival time was 14 months and 47 months, respectively. Patients with high numbers of Tregs and low numbers of CD8+T lymphocytes in the primary tumor had a poorer prognosis than those with low numbers of Tregs and high numbers of CD8+T lymphocytes (p=0.034, p=0.043). Multivariate Cox proportional hazard regression analysis showed that HLA-G expression (hazard ratio: 2.662; 95% confidence interval: 1.242-5.723; p=0.012) and stage (hazard ratio: 2.012;95% confidence interval: 1.112-3.715; p=0.041) were independent unfavorable factors for patient survival. Conclusions: We found a significant positive correlation between HLA-G expression and the number of tumor infiltrating Tregs (p=0.01) and a negative correlation with the number of CD8+T lymphocytes (p=0.041). HLA-G may protect gastric cancer cells from cytolysis by inducing Foxp3+Treg lymphocytes and suppressing CD8+T lymphocytes.

  • Objective: To discuss the significance of DOG1, CD117 and PDGFRA in the diagnosis of gastrointestinal stromal tumors (GISTs), and analyze their correlations with clinicopathological features and risk ranking. Method: DOG1, CD117 and PDGFRA were detected with IHC Envision ldpe-g-nvp in 63 GISTs and 43 cases of non-GISTs, and analyzed for relations with clinicopathological factors (gender, age, location, tumor size, mitotic phase, histology) and risk degree. Results: The positive expression rate of DOG1, CD117 and PDGFRA in GISTs was 84.1% (53/63), 90.5% (57/63), 53.2% (33/63), respectively. Among the 6 CD117 negative cases, all were DOG1 positive and 5 were PDGFRA positive. Rates in patients with non-GISTs was 11.6%, 16.3%, 6.98%, respectively. Expression of DOG1 and PDGFRA demonstrated no significant variation with gender, age, position, tumor size, mitotic phase, histology, and risk rank. However, CD117 was related with position and histology (P=0.008 and P=0.045), those in the mesentery having a higher positive rate than those derived from stomach, small intestine, colon and rectum (50.0% vs 94.7%, P=0.008). Furthermore CD117 was also highly expressed in spindle and epithele types. Conclusions: DOG1 had a good sensitivity and specificity as a kind of newly discovered marker, especially for KIT negative GISTs. However, DOG1, CD117 and PDGFRA cannot be used for assessing the rish of patients.

  • Gene expression profiling (GEP) has identified several molecular subtypes of breast cancer, with different clinico-pathologic features and exhibiting different responses to chemotherapy. However, GEP is expensive and not available in the developing countries where the majority of patients present at advanced stage. The St Gallen Consensus in 2011 proposed use of a simplified, four immunohistochemical (IHC) biomarker panel (ER, PR, HER2, Ki67/Tumor Grade) for molecular classification. The present study was conducted in 75 newly diagnosed patients of breast cancer with large (>5cm) tumors to evaluate the association of IHC surrogate molecular subtype with the clinical response to presurgical chemotherapy, evaluated by the WHO criteria, 3 weeks after the third cycle of 5 flourouracil, adriamycin, cyclophosphamide (FAC regimen). The subtypes of luminal, basal-like and HER2 enriched were found to account for 36.0 % (27/75), 34.7 % (26/75) and 29.3% (22/75) of patients respectively. Ten were luminal A and 14 luminal B (8 HER2 negative and 6HER2 positive). The triple negative breast cancer (TNBC) was most sensitive to chemotherapy with 19% achieving clinical-complete-response (cCR) followed by HER2 enriched (2/22 (9%) cCR), luminal B (1/6 (7%) cCR) and luminal A (0/10 (0%) cCR). Heterogeneity was observed within each subgroup, being most marked in the TNBC although the most responding tumors, 8% developing clinical-progressive-disease. The study supports association of molecular subtypes with response to chemotherapy in patients with advanced breast cancer and the existence of further heterogeneity within subtypes.
